ScottDoffek MILWAUKEE – The University of Wisconsin-Milwaukee baseball team has announced the addition of five student-athletes who will compete next season for the Panthers.

Milwaukee head coach Scott Doffek stated today that Jordan Guth of Onalaska, Wis., Jim Lundstrom of Crete, Ill., Drew Pearson of Racine, Wis., Kyle Spurley of Linden, Wis., and Mark Strey of Marshfield, Wis., will all enroll at UWM and participate next season.

Guth finished up his career at Onalaska High School this season by earning Wisconsin Baseball Coaches Association All-District Second Team and All-Mississippi Valley Conference Second Team honors. He went 7-1 with an ERA of 1.53, striking out 94 batters while allowing just 18 walks and 42 hits in 64 innings of work while his team went 16-11 overall. As a junior, he went 8-0 with a 1.66 ERA in nine games, leading Onalaska to a 24-4 record overall. He finished with five complete games and two shutouts. The all-conference pitcher has played in the WBCA Brewers Classic All-Star game and is also a National Honor Society member who has earned all-academic honors. A member of the 2008 Wisconsin State Baseball Legion championship team, Guth was also an all-state hockey player.

ScottDoffek MILWAUKEE – University of Wisconsin-Milwaukee Athletic Director George Koonce has announced that head baseball coach Scott Doffek has signed a new three-year contract.

Doffek just concluded his third season as the head coach of the Panthers. He was named the seventh head baseball coach in school history on Sept. 25, 2006.

"I am pleased that we have been able to agree with Scott Doffek on a new three-year contract," Koonce said. "Scott has given many great years of service to our department and university, and has led our baseball program to tremendous success. We look forward to having Scott with us for many years to come."

TEMPE, Ariz. – Six home runs, including two each from Jason Kipnis and Carlos Ramirez, helped the No. 6 Arizona State University baseball team to a 13-5 victory over Wisconsin-Milwaukee in the opening game of a doubleheader Saturday at Winkles Field-Packard Stadium at Brock Ballpark. The Sun Devils improved to 2-0 on the season with the win. Read the rest of this entry »

The first two weeks of practice have gone very well. The players came back ready for practice and in great shape from off season workouts. The first few days went slowly trying to get everyone into the rhythm again, working with class schedules and making sure players were on time was half the battle. The other half was working with our facility schedule. Here at Milwaukee we are an urban campus that is land locked. We have a 93 acre campus on the upper east side of the city. We have two on campus athletic facilities, the soccer field which is natural grass and the women’s basketball arena. Read the rest of this entry »

The Milwaukee Panthers had an up-and-down season in 2008, ending with a 25-36 record overall and a fifth-place showing in the Horizon League standings. But, it was the “up” that the season ended on that will be long remembered. Entering the Horizon League Tournament as the No. 5 seed, the Panthers played a special week of baseball, upsetting three different teams on the way to the tournament finale, where they came up just a victory away from their first NCAA Regional since the 2002 season. INDIANAPOLIS — The University of Illinois at Chicago has been picked to win the 2009 Horizon League Baseball Championship in balloting by the conference’s seven head coaches.

UIC received 36 points and the maximum six first-place votes as coaches were not permitted to vote for their own teams. The Flames posted a 35-22 overall record and 17-6 Horizon League mark a season ago en route to their fourth conference crown in six years. Read the rest of this entry »

University of Wisconsin-Milwaukee baseball coach Scott Doffek has made the 2009 schedule available to the general public. The schedule, which is still tentative at this time, again features a lengthy road stint (22 games) to begin the season, playing big-name teams like Arizona State and Michigan as the season begins. The home opener is scheduled for April 3rd against UIC.
